The UW School of Dentistry Regional Initiatives in Dental Education program (RIDE) has established the Arthur C. DiMarco RIDE Leadership Award.
The award is given to one Eastern Washington University or UW faculty member, staff, student, or RIDE community preceptor or clinic administrator who exemplifies the outstanding dedication to dental education and expanding access to dental care in rural and underserved communities.
The UWSOD Office of Regional Affairs established the award ahead of EWU RIDE Associate Director Dr. Art DiMarco’s retirement, which will take place at the end of the calendar year. It celebrates Dr. DiMarco’s extraordinary contributions to dental education, honoring his lasting impact on the RIDE program, which stems all the way back to the program’s beginnings in 2006.
As one of the program’s founding leaders, Dr. DiMarco’s dedication has shaped RIDE into a nationally recognized model of innovation, collaboration and service. At the open house and ribbon-cutting ceremony for RIDE’s new Oral Health Training Center, Dr. DiMarco was recognized.
“Dr. DiMarco set the bar for what a mentor should be,” said Dr. Patty Martin, RIDE Class of 2012. “His kindness, compassion, and optimism were a bright light through the first year of dental school. I always smile when his name comes up.”
“Patients always comment that I’m the first dentist who never had a problem getting them numb. Dr. Dimarco is who I always have, and still do, thank for that,” said Dr. Michael McKay, RIDE Class of 2016.
“Dr. DiMarco was my professor not once but twice for both the hygiene and dental programs,” said Dr. Nadia Grishin, RIDE Class of 2020. “His humility, brilliance and unwavering dedication to his students was inspiring and deeply personal. I will forever appreciate everything he did to help me get where I am today.”
The very first recipient of the Art DiMarco RIDE Leadership Award is Barbara Davis, the RIDE EWU Instructional Classroom Support Tech. Davis is a registered dental assistant and a pillar in the day-to-day lives of the RIDE students in Spokane. She was instrumental in designing, building and opening the new RIDE Simulation Lab.
Davis was also recognized at the ribbon-cutting ceremony. “Thank you, Barbara, for being the heart of our lab and our ‘school mom’ through the first whirlwind year of dental school,” said Gunnar Velikanje, RIDE Class of 2026.
“Your hard work, patience, and constant support made all the difference as we found our footing. We truly couldn’t have done it without you! Thank you for everything you’ve done to guide, encourage and care for us along the way.”
Dr. Cheon Joo Yoon, EWU RIDE Director, and Dr. Shweta Puri, EWU RIDE Associate Director, will take over Dr. DiMarco’s responsibilities upon his retirement at the end of the year.
